A drone in the eastern Yemeni province of Marib reportedly struck a vehicle carrying five suspected Al-Qaeda militants, early Sunday, according to Reuters, citing local residents. The attack in the Raghwan district left the bodies unrecognizable. So far, neither Al-Qaeda, nor the US forces, which repeatedly conduct drone and air strikes in Yemen, have commented on the incident.
